Scope and Contents

This collection includes a ledger from the Harber and Huguely store in Richmond, Kentucky in the early 1900s. The ledger lists accounts for all the people purchasing from the store thus documenting the economy of Richmond at the time. It also documents the education of Frances Mason Samuels.

Biographical or Historical Information

Frances Mason Samuels (1920-2009) was born in Canton, Ohio to Everett and Lula Wertz Samuels. She was a member of the First Christian Church of Richmond, and had done clerical work for Burnam & Harber and Whitaker & Vencil Insurance Companies. Mrs. Cosby was a member of Madison Country Club and the VFW Auxiliary. She was married to Albert Cosby (1914-1995).
